Basic Maintenance Tips

  • Keep it clean: Regularly wipe the wheel and base with a soft, dry cloth to remove dust and debris.
  • Avoid liquids: Do not expose the device to liquids or moisture to prevent electrical damage.
  • Check connections: Ensure all cables and connectors are securely attached and free from damage.
  • Update firmware: Keep the device’s firmware up to date through the Thrustmaster software for optimal performance.

Advanced Maintenance and Troubleshooting

If you encounter issues such as unresponsive controls, unusual noises, or inconsistent force feedback, consider the following steps:

  • Calibrate the device: Use the Thrustmaster calibration tools to reset the device’s settings.
  • Inspect for wear: Check the wheel and pedals for signs of physical damage or excessive wear.
  • Lubricate moving parts: Apply appropriate lubricants to the wheel’s moving joints if necessary, following manufacturer guidelines.
  • Reset to factory settings: Restore default settings through the software if issues persist.

Storage Tips for Longevity

Proper storage can significantly extend the life of your Thrustmaster T300 RS GT 2026. When not in use:

  • Store in a cool, dry place: Avoid areas with high humidity or temperature fluctuations.
  • Use a protective cover: Keep the device covered to prevent dust accumulation.
  • Avoid direct sunlight: Prolonged exposure to sunlight can damage the materials.
  • Disconnect cables: Unplug cables to prevent strain on connectors.
